A document that specifies educational goals and plans for a child with special needs is referred to as a(n) individualized education plan (IEP).
What is an IEP and what is its purpose?
Also known as a "IEP," an individualized education program is a customized curriculum. This is a strategy or program designed to guarantee that a student in a primary or secondary school who has a disability is given the specific instruction and support they require.
